What does virtual currency wallet address tracking mean?

Virtual currency wallet address tracking refers to tracking the activities and related information of virtual currency wallet addresses by monitoring and analyzing transaction data on the blockchain. This process involves determining the transactions, fund flows, and ownership associated with a specific wallet address.

Methods to track wallet address

Methods to track wallet address include:

  • Blockchain browser: Such as blockchain.info and Etherscan, provide public records of blockchain transactions and wallet addresses.
  • Forensic companies: Such as Chainalysis and Elliptic, provide specialized tools and services for tracking and analyzing virtual currency transactions.
  • Open source software: Such as BTCTracker and Monero Explorer, allowing users to track wallet addresses themselves.

Purposes of tracking wallet addresses

Tracing wallet addresses is useful for the following purposes:

  • Law Enforcement: Investigate virtual currency-related crimes, such as money laundering and fraud.
  • Compliance: Comply with Anti-Money Laundering (AML) and Know Your Customer (KYC) regulations.
  • Risk Management: Evaluate the risks and compliance issues associated with specific wallet addresses.
  • Asset Tracking: Track stolen or lost virtual currency.
  • Market Analysis: Analyze wallet address holding and trading patterns to understand market trends and price dynamics.

Things to note

You need to pay attention to the following when tracking wallet addresses:

  • Privacy issues: Tracking wallet addresses can be a privacy violation because they can reveal transaction history and fund flow.
  • Technical Complexity: Tracing wallet addresses requires a deep understanding of blockchain technology and forensic tools.
  • Anonymity: Certain virtual currencies, such as Monero, offer features that enhance anonymity, making it more challenging to track wallet addresses.
  • False Positives: The tracking algorithm can sometimes produce false matches, so it's important to verify the results before making a decision.
